The restoration market serving Cissna Park, IL, is characterized by regional and national franchise providers that cover a wide rural area. Due to the village's small size, there are no standalone restoration companies based directly within it. The competition to serve Cissna Park primarily comes from established franchises located in nearby hubs like Watseka (Iroquois County seat) and the Kankakee/Bradley area. These companies compete on response time, customer service, and insurance coordination expertise. The average quality of service is high, as these franchises require standardized training, certifications (like IICRC), and adherence to corporate protocols. Pricing is typically not advertised and is based on industry-standard pricing software (like Xactimate), with costs primarily driven by the scope of damage and often paid directly by homeowners' insurance companies. For residents, the key differentiator is often which company can arrive on-site the quickest following a disaster.

The most common emergencies are water damage from basement seepage or burst pipes and storm damage from high winds/hail. These are highly seasonal; spring brings heavy rains and thaw-related flooding, while summer and fall thunderstorms can cause roof and siding damage. Winters pose a significant risk of frozen pipe bursts, especially in older homes, making year-round vigilance important.
A reputable IICRC-certified provider serving Iroquois County should offer 24/7 emergency service and typically arrive within 60-90 minutes. Given Cissna Park's rural location, confirm their service radius covers your specific address. Immediate response is critical to prevent secondary damage like mold, which can begin in as little as 24-48 hours in our humid Midwest climate.
Yes. For structural repairs, you may need a building permit from the Village of Cissna Park. Furthermore, any mold remediation project exceeding 10 square feet (or less if HVAC is involved) must be performed by a licensed Illinois Department of Public Health (IDPH) Mold Remediation Contractor. Always verify your provider holds this required state license.
Prioritize companies that are locally established, IICRC-certified, and licensed by the State of Illinois for mold and asbestos work. Check for strong references within Iroquois County and verify they carry full insurance. Be wary of "storm chasers" who follow severe weather; a local company will be here for future service and warranty work.
Most standard policies cover sudden, accidental events like storm damage or a burst pipe. However, coverage for gradual seepage or flooding typically requires a separate flood insurance policy. It's crucial to document all damage with photos before any cleanup begins and to use a restoration company experienced in working directly with Illinois insurers to navigate claims smoothly.
